Kill/Death/Assist ratio is the most visible, and most deceptive, metric. It creates heroes and scapegoats, but rarely tells you why a game was won or lost. A support who finishes 1/5/18 might be blamed for feeding, while their vision control and timely crowd control enabled every objective. Conversely, a top laner with a sparkling 8/2/3 score might have achieved those kills through constant jungle attention, leaving the rest of the map vulnerable. The first step is to stop using KDA as a verdict and start using it as a question. A high death count asks, "Were these deaths necessary sacrifices for objective control, or preventable positioning errors?" A low kill participation prompts, "Was this player consistently absent from pivotal fights, or were they creating map pressure elsewhere?" Framing stats this way shifts the conversation from assigning credit or blame to diagnosing gameplay.
Contextualizing Damage Dealt
Total damage to champions is another common trap. Seeing a mid-lane mage at the top feels correct, but it misses crucial nuance. You need to ask about damage distribution. Did 70% of that damage get poured into an unkillable Ornn, providing no strategic advantage, while the enemy carries went untouched? Reviewing fight replays to see who was targeted, and when, is far more telling than the raw number.
For bot lanes, compare damage dealt between the AD carry and support. A large disparity is normal, but a negligible one might indicate the support is taking risky trades or the ADC is playing too passively. The stat alone doesn't tell you which; it simply flags the lane dynamic for review.
Identifying Your Team's True Win Conditions
Every team composition has inherent win conditions: split-push, teamfight at 3 items, objective stacking, pick comps. Your post-game stats are a report card on how well you executed that plan. Look for the metrics that directly support your chosen strategy.
If you drafted a split-push composition with a Fiora top, your critical stats aren't just Fiora's CS. They are Turret Damage dealt by your team, Herald usage, and the number of times the enemy team was forced to send 2+ players to stop her. If those numbers are low, your practice needs to focus on map synchronization: when does the team apply pressure elsewhere, and how does Fiora know it's safe to push?
For a teamfight comp, key indicators include Vision Score around major objectives 90 seconds before they spawn, Crowd Control Score landed in fights, and crucially, the timing of allied death recaps. Did your key damage dealers die before the fight started to a flank? That's a vision and positioning failure, not a teamfight failure.

Armed with contextual questions from the stats, you now need a review framework that doesn't devolve into rambling. Allocate a strict 30-minute block immediately after a play session for 2-3 games. This structure prevents fatigue and keeps focus high.
Start with the result. Did you win or lose? Then, immediately move to your draft's intended win condition. "We wanted to siege with Jayce poke and get early Dragons." Now, use 2-3 key stats to evaluate that. "We got first Dragon, but our total Turret Damage was lower than theirs despite the poke comp. Why?" Let the stats guide you to specific moments in the replay.
Here's a simple, effective framework many competitive Flex teams use:
- Macro Check (5 mins): Review the objective timeline. Did we take trades when we lost a fight? Did we secure vision before objectives?
- Key Fight Autopsy (10 mins): Pick one fight that decided the game. Watch it without sound first, just watching positioning. Then watch with comms. Did our actions match our calls?
- Individual Focus (10 mins): Each player names one personal metric they are working on (e.g., "my vision score per minute") and reviews their performance against it, using the post-game stat as evidence.
- One Action Item (5 mins): Agree on ONE specific thing to practice or communicate differently next session. Examples: "Call 'enemy jungler missing' louder," or "We will practice our level 2 jungle invade twice in customs."
Translating Insights into Focused Drills
This is where most teams stall. They identify a problem like "our vision collapses after laning phase" but then just say "let's ward more" next game. That's not practice; it's a vague hope. You must design a drill that isolates and pressures the specific skill.
For the vision example, create a custom game drill. Play a 15-minute segment where the ONLY goal is to maintain three wards in the enemy jungle quadrant between 10 and 15 minutes. You are not allowed to fight unless attacked. The success metric isn't kills, it's whether you can track the enemy jungler's pathing via deep vision. This turns an abstract concept into a tangible, repeatable exercise.
For teamfight execution, use the Practice Tool in a controlled way. Have your front line and back line practice a specific engage combo against dummy targets with a focus on spacing. How far back does the ADC stand when Malphite ults? Run the combo ten times. The goal is muscle memory for positioning, not damage output.

Even the most disciplined teams hit a ceiling with self-analysis. You become blind to your own systemic flaws because you all share the same assumptions. You might brilliantly analyze why you lost a fight at Dragon, but completely miss that your entire draft strategy is outdated in the current meta.
Common blind spots include predictable jungle pathing that stats won't show, repetitive item builds that don't adapt to the game state, and communication tics that shut down information flow. The in-game stats tell you what happened, but they often lack the context to explain why it keeps happening. This is where external perspective becomes valuable.
When Stats Contradict Feelings
You'll encounter moments where the stats say one thing, but the team's feeling is another. "The stats say we won vision, but we felt constantly flanked." This discrepancy is a goldmine. It usually means you're placing wards in predictable, easily cleared locations, or you're not using the information the vision provides. Resolving this requires someone to map your team's typical ward placements and compare them to optimal locations, a tedious but enlightening process that often gets skipped internally.
Another frequent trap is over-indexing on a single player's performance metrics. If your mid laner's CS is consistently 20 below their lane opponent, the instinct is to tell them to "farm better." But a deeper look might reveal your jungle never provides lane pressure, forcing them to sacrifice waves to avoid ganks. Fixing the CS problem then becomes a team coordination issue, not an individual mechanics one.

The final step is weaving these elements into a weekly rhythm that doesn't burn out the team. A sustainable cycle alternates between playing, reviewing, and drilling.
A sample week for a serious Flex 5 team could look like this: Monday is dedicated review and planning night (using the framework above). Tuesday and Thursday are primary play sessions, where you actively try to implement your one agreed-upon action item. Wednesday is a short, 60-minute custom game drill session focused on one isolated skill. Friday is a more relaxed play session to solidify the week's work.
The critical element is closing the feedback loop. The action item from Monday's review must be the explicit focus of Tuesday's play. Then, on the next review, you don't just look at general stats; you ask, "How did we do on our action item? What helped or hindered us?" This creates a tangible sense of progression beyond win/loss.
Without this cycle, teams often practice in a plateau. They play game after game, review sporadically, and wonder why they aren't climbing. The difference between playing and practicing is intention, and intention is built through this structured translation of stats into plans.

What are the most important stats for a Flex 5 support player to track for improvement?
Move beyond KDA. Prioritize Vision Score per minute, especially vision cleared. Track Crowd Control Score to see the impact of your engages and peels. Also, review Death Timings relative to objective spawns. A death 45 seconds before Dragon is far more costly than one during a slow reset period.
Our team wins lane often but loses the mid-game. Which stats should we check first?
Examine your team's Gold Difference at 15 minutes versus the Gold Difference at 25 minutes. If you're losing your lead, look at Post-15 Minute Turret Damage and Objective Damage to Baron. This often points to poor sidelane management or indecisive objective setups after laning ends, not individual performance.
Is there a tool that automatically compares our Flex 5 stats over time?
While third-party sites like OP.GG or U.GG track historical match data, they aren't designed for team-centric trend analysis. For consistent tracking, manually log 3-4 key team stats (like pre-objective vision score, first Turret rate) in a shared document. This custom log often reveals patterns automated profiles miss.
How can we practice teamfighting if we can't replicate a real 5v5 in customs?
Break the fight into phases. Use the Practice Tool to drill your team's specific engage combo (e.g., Malphite ult followed by Miss Fortune ult) against dummies for timing. Then, in a normal custom, practice the 30 seconds BEFORE the fight: how you set up vision, secure flank angles, and bait key cooldowns. The execution often fails in the setup.
